India, July 25 -- Coming after pressure from the Cockroach Janta Party's massive protest and the Congress-led Opposition's sustained stance, Union education minister Dharmendra Pradhan's resignation on Saturday marked a major departure from Prime Minister Narendra Modi's long-held approach of standing by ministers facing political pressure.

The resignation, once formally accepted, would become the first instance of a Union Cabinet-rank minister stepping down while explicitly taking responsibility for a major governance controversy during Modi's tenure of 12 years as PM so far.
